Definitions from Black's Law Dictionary: 2nd Edition and Ballentine's Law Dictionary as are available for each term in each dictionary.
  • Ballentine's Law Dictionary

    Blank bar, a plea in trespass compelling the plaintiff to name the place.

  • Black's Law Dictionary: 2nd Edition

    In pleading. (Otherwise called "blank bar.") A plea to compel the plaintiff to assign the particular place where the trespass has been committed. Steph. PI. 256.
